If you've just bought a rural property and eventually want to build a home on it, one of your early tasks will be to clear the property to some degree. While you could hire a land clearing service to do this work for you, someone who enjoys do-it-yourself work might want to handle this project themselves. If so, you'll want to rent a compact tractor from a local equipment rental service. One of these tractors can help with a surprisingly long list of tasks that you'll need to complete to get the property looking the way you want. Here are three ways to use a rented compact tractor when clearing a property.

Dragging Trees

Clearing a property often requires you to cut down some trees. While you might want to leave some trees up, you'll need to remove those that will interfere with the construction of the home. There are lots of ways to approach cutting down the trees, but one option is to cut them and then drag them to the edge of the road with your portable tractor. This way, you can have someone come and pick them up to use as firewood — and pay you, which is a nice way to earn a little money from the work you're doing. It would be all but impossible to move the tree trunks to the edge of the road without a tractor.

Piling Brush

On rural properties, a common way to get rid of the brush that you clear is to burn it. Provided that you're legally able to do so in your area, you can use your rented compact tractor to make a large pile of brush that you can eventually set on fire. Loading the brush into the bucket of the tractor and piling it in a designated area is much quicker and physically easier than carrying the brush by hand or using a wheelbarrow.

Leveling The Ground

You can also use your compact tractor to level the ground to your desired look. You can lift large rocks out of the ground with the bucket and get rid of them, and then drag the bucket across the surface of the ground to give it a smooth, graded shape. Rural properties can often be unlevel when you buy them, and spending a good amount of time leveling the ground with your tractor can make the property start to take shape.
